How they compare
Botswana currently reports 0.0001 t per person against 0 t per person in Cuba, a difference of 0.0001 t per person.
That makes Botswana's figure about 1.9 times Cuba's.
Across all 16 years both countries report, Botswana has been ahead every year.
Botswana ranks 127th and Cuba ranks 130th of 178 countries.
Botswana has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
